Understanding the Basics of 1-800 Numbers for Business

1-800 numbers are toll-free phone lines that offer businesses a unique way to engage with their customers without incurring charges for calls. These numbers have become an essential tool for customer service, marketing campaigns, and expanding a company’s reach across regions. Businesses of all sizes can leverage the benefits of 1-800 numbers to enhance customer satisfaction and boost sales by providing a simple, cost-effective communication channel.

In essence, 1-800 numbers can help businesses establish a professional image, improve customer trust, and enhance accessibility. To understand how they function and how they can be beneficial, it's important to break down the key features and usage of these numbers.

How 1-800 Numbers Work

These phone numbers are routed through a toll-free service, meaning the business owner is responsible for paying for incoming calls. However, there are numerous advantages to using them:

  • Nationwide Accessibility: No matter where the customer is calling from, they won’t incur any charges, which can increase the number of inquiries and interactions with your business.
  • Professional Image: Using a 1-800 number creates an impression of a larger, more established company, even if you are a small business.
  • Marketing Benefits: These numbers are easy to remember and can become part of your brand identity, which is particularly valuable in advertising.

Setting Up a Profitable Call Forwarding System

One of the key strategies for monetizing a toll-free number is setting up an efficient call forwarding system. This allows you to manage incoming calls and direct them to the right channels, ensuring you never miss a potential business opportunity. By leveraging call forwarding, you can optimize your time and resources while increasing the chances of turning calls into profits.

To establish a successful forwarding system, there are several steps and considerations that can significantly impact profitability. From selecting the right forwarding options to tracking performance, the setup should align with your business goals. Below are the essential steps to follow when configuring a call forwarding system for maximum revenue potential.

Key Components of a Call Forwarding System

  • Call Routing Options: Choose from different routing options, such as forwarding calls to local numbers, mobile phones, or voicemail, depending on your availability.
  • Business Hours: Set specific hours for forwarding calls, ensuring you're only forwarding during peak hours to reduce costs and maximize efficiency.
  • Geographical Routing: If your business operates in multiple regions, forward calls to the appropriate location or team to provide localized customer service.

Steps to Set Up Call Forwarding

  1. Choose a Call Forwarding Service: Research service providers and select one that fits your business needs. Consider factors like pricing, reliability, and available features.
  2. Configure Call Forwarding Rules: Set rules for when and where calls should be forwarded. Options include forwarding all calls or only certain ones (e.g., based on time or caller's location).
  3. Test the System: Once setup is complete, perform several test calls to ensure that the forwarding system works as intended and that calls are routed correctly.

Remember, an effective call forwarding system not only enhances customer experience but also provides valuable insights into call volume, peak hours, and customer preferences.

Cost and Profit Tracking

It's essential to monitor costs and profitability related to call forwarding. Different call forwarding services have varying pricing structures, which can affect your bottom line. Keeping track of the following can help you gauge profitability:

Cost Type Details
Setup Fees Initial cost for configuring your system, including any hardware or software needed.
Monthly Fees Recurring charges for maintaining your call forwarding service, often based on call volume or duration.
Per Call Fees Charges for forwarding individual calls, which may vary depending on distance or service provider.

By tracking these costs and optimizing your forwarding strategy, you can ensure that your call forwarding system contributes positively to your revenue generation efforts.

Monetizing Call Traffic through Lead Generation

Generating revenue through call traffic can be highly profitable when combined with effective lead generation strategies. Businesses can leverage toll-free numbers, such as 1-800 numbers, to attract potential clients, capture their contact details, and pass them on to interested parties or companies willing to pay for qualified leads. This approach ensures that both the business and the lead generation service provider benefit from the call traffic.

One of the most common methods to monetize call traffic is by focusing on high-intent leads. By offering specialized services or products that require personalized consultations, businesses can filter and capture relevant customer details. Once calls are routed, the information can be sold or used for follow-up purposes, creating a continuous revenue stream.

Steps for Effective Lead Generation with Call Traffic

  • Offer a targeted service or product that appeals to a niche audience.
  • Use a toll-free number to make it easier for potential clients to reach you.
  • Qualify the leads through a scripted conversation or an automated system.
  • Collect key information like name, contact details, and specific interests.
  • Sell or forward qualified leads to interested companies or agencies.

Key Benefits:

Lead generation using call traffic creates an opportunity for businesses to earn while providing valuable customer insights to other companies in need of those leads.

Pricing Models for Lead Generation

Model Revenue Per Lead Notes
Cost-Per-Call Fixed rate per call Suitable for calls with minimal filtering.
Cost-Per-Lead (CPL) Varies based on lead quality More profitable for high-quality, qualified leads.
Revenue Sharing Commission-based Best for ongoing relationships with companies.

Tracking and Analyzing Call Data for Business Insights

Understanding customer behavior and improving operational strategies is key to maximizing profits with a toll-free number. By leveraging call data, businesses can gain valuable insights into their audience's preferences and needs, enhancing the overall customer experience and boosting revenue generation. Tracking key metrics helps in refining marketing campaigns, customer service, and even product offerings.

Analyzing call patterns, call duration, frequency, and peak call times can lead to better resource allocation, helping businesses optimize staffing and improve efficiency. This data-driven approach allows businesses to make more informed decisions, improving both customer satisfaction and overall performance.

Key Metrics to Track

  • Call Volume: Track the number of incoming calls over a given period to identify trends and demand spikes.
  • Call Duration: Measure how long calls last to evaluate customer engagement and satisfaction.
  • Peak Call Times: Identify the times when call volume is highest to adjust staffing and improve customer service.
  • Conversion Rates: Determine how many calls result in a sale, sign-up, or desired action to gauge the effectiveness of marketing strategies.

Analyzing Call Data Effectively

Using advanced analytics tools, businesses can visualize call data in easy-to-understand formats. These tools enable managers to pinpoint specific issues, whether it's customer service delays, frequent inquiries about certain products, or missed sales opportunities. Here’s a breakdown of key steps:

  1. Integrate Data Sources: Combine call data with other business metrics such as sales and marketing data to get a comprehensive view.
  2. Set Benchmarks: Establish benchmarks based on historical data to identify patterns and set performance goals.
  3. Optimize Processes: Use the insights gained to improve call handling, adjust marketing strategies, or even refine product offerings.

By tracking and analyzing call data, businesses can transform raw information into actionable insights, driving profitability and long-term success.
